[Dovecot] Migration to Dovecot 2.2.12 - How to trigger full site indexing
Hi list,
We are in the process of migrating our old (dovecot 1.2.4 based) mail
system to the new one:
- Centos 6 x86_64
- Dovecot 2.2.12
- Users in an openldap directory
- clucene FTS
I'm trying to trigger a full indexing for all the user and all their
mailboxes (avoiding them to individually trigger it using a search
within their MUA). I'm trying to use the "doveadm index" command.
First question, is there some sort of 'wildcard' option for the name of
the mailbox to index, as I dont know all the mailboxes's names the users
have created (beside the regular Sent Inbox Trash and Drafts ?
Second question I've tried:
# doveadm -D index -A Sent
which gave me:
doveadm(root): Error: User listing returned failure
doveadm: Error: Failed to iterate through some users
Can the '-A' option work with ldap backend ?

On Wednesday, April 9, 2014 12:57:13 PM CEST, kadafax at gmail.com wrote:> Hi list, > > We are in the process of migrating our old (dovecot 1.2.4 > based) mail system to the new one: > > - Centos 6 x86_64 > - Dovecot 2.2.12 > - Users in an openldap directory > - clucene FTS > > I'm trying to trigger a full indexing for all the user and all > their mailboxes (avoiding them to individually trigger it using > a search within their MUA). I'm trying to use the "doveadm > index" command. > > First question, is there some sort of 'wildcard' option for the > name of the mailbox to index, as I dont know all the mailboxes's > names the users have created (beside the regular Sent Inbox > Trash and Drafts ?I'm using a totally different set of things, but at least dovecot and clucene are agreeable.. ;-) You should have a fts plugin to doveadm that should solve this issue: doveadm fts rescan doveadm fts optimize That's what I use to trigger rebuilds.> Second question I've tried: > # doveadm -D index -A Sent > which gave me: > doveadm(root): Error: User listing returned failure > doveadm: Error: Failed to iterate through some users > > Can the '-A' option work with ldap backend ?http://wiki2.dovecot.org/AuthDatabase/LDAP/Userdb # For using doveadm -A: iterate_attrs = uid=user iterate_filter = (objectClass=posixAccount) Are you defining iterate_* for your userdb?
